Gluten-Free Chicken Enchiladas
These gluten-free chicken enchiladas are comfort food at its finest, featuring shredded chicken wrapped in corn tortillas and smothered in a savory red sauce. Each bite is packed with melted cheese and authentic spices for a crowd-pleasing dinner.
- Prep time: 11 minutes
- Cook time: 26 minutes
- Total time: 37 minutes
- Servings: 4
- Difficulty: Easy
- Cuisine: International
Ingredients
- 12 corn tortillas
- 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ded
- 2 cups red enchilada sauce
- 2 cups shredded monterey jack cheese
- 0.5 cup diced yellow onion
- 1 teaspoon cumin
- 1 teaspoon chili powder
- 0.25 cup fresh cilantro, chopped
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- Salt to taste
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it.
- Sauté onion in olive oil until soft, then mix with shredded chicken, cumin, chili powder, and half the cheese.
- Warm the corn tortillas in the microwave for 30 seconds so they do not break when rolling.
- Spoon a generous amount of chicken mixture into each tortilla and roll tightly.
- Spread half a cup of enchilada sauce on the bottom of a 9x13 baking dish.
- Place rolled enchiladas seam-side down in the dish.
- Cover with remaining sauce and the rest of the cheese.
- Bake for 20-25 minutes until the cheese is bubbly and slightly browned.
Tips
- Warm the corn tortillas before rolling to prevent them from cracking.
- Use a high-quality gluten-free enchilada sauce to ensure the dish stays safe for those with celiac disease.
- Top with fresh cilantro and avocado slices for extra brightness.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use flour tortillas?
This recipe is specifically designed to be gluten-free, so corn tortillas are the best choice.
How do I store leftovers?
Store covered in the refrigerator for up to 3 days and reheat in the oven.
Can I make this vegetarian?
Yes, substitute the chicken with black beans or sautéed mushrooms.
